Understanding the Cape Cod Market

Cape Cod’s real estate market has its own rhythms, influenced by tourism, seasonality, and zoning regulations that may differ significantly from town to town. While online listings can provide a broad view of what’s available, local knowledge is essential when it comes to assessing property values, understanding flood zones, and navigating town-specific guidelines about quick-term leases or renovations.

A local real estate agent knows these intricacies. They can point out which areas have higher flood insurance premiums, which homes are overpriced primarily based on latest sales, and methods to approach properties with septic systems or conservation land restrictions—frequent points on the Cape.

The Case for Buying Without an Agent

Some buyers prefer to go it alone, particularly within the age of digital listings. Sites like Zillow, Redfin, and Realtor.com supply loads of property data and photos. In the event you’re an skilled buyer who feels assured about negotiating, scheduling inspections, and understanding legal documents, you would possibly really feel an agent isn’t necessary.

Also, buyers could assume they’ll save money by skipping the agent. Nevertheless, in most transactions, the seller pays the commission for both the listing and purchaser’s agents. Which means using a purchaser’s agent typically doesn’t cost you anything additional, however not utilizing one won’t lower the price of the home.

Hidden Benefits of a Buyer’s Agent

A seasoned real estate agent brings more to the table than just showing homes. They act as your advocate during negotiations, assist craft competitive offers, and make sure that deadlines within the purchase contract are met. In competitive Cape Cod markets like Chatham, Provincetown, or Falmouth, having an agent could be the sting you might want to get your provide accepted.

Agents also have access to off-market listings and early alerts about worth drops or new homes coming soon. They often know which homes are sitting as a consequence of hidden problems—details you may miss when you’re shopping for in your own.

Additionally, an agent will guide you through inspections, explain local codes, and join you with trustworthy professionals similar to attorneys, mortgage brokers, and inspectors who concentrate on Cape properties.

Legal and Logistical Considerations

Massachusetts law doesn’t require buyers to use a real estate agent, however the process of shopping for property consists of legal contracts, contingencies, and disclosures that may be confusing. Real estate agents are trained to identify potential red flags and guarantee paperwork is handled accurately, reducing your legal risk.

Also, consider the time and effort involved in scheduling showings, researching listings, arranging inspections, and following up with multiple parties throughout the process. A real estate agent handles all of this, liberating you to concentrate on choosing the proper property.

When You Would possibly Not Want an Agent

If you happen to’re shopping for from a family member or shut friend, or if you’re a real estate professional your self, you may not need a purchaser’s agent. Some cash buyers who are skilled within the Cape market also opt to work directly with listing agents. However for the typical homepurchaser, the risks of going solo often outweigh the benefits.
